SYRIZA: Alonas match. Tsipras for the polls on May 15 with ‘bait’ the increases in Energy

By Niki Zorba

The short Easter break for Alexis Tsipras and SYRIZA ends – and officially – with him and his party entering the pre-election rhythm in view of the ballot box on May 15, which is the president’s big bet: Himself has given the character of a poll to the internal party process for the election of a president (ie himself) and the new Central Committee from the party base.

The challenge for Koumoundourou is great as the turnout of members in the internal party polls is a poll and is qualifying for the electoral performance of SYRIZA in the elections – as Alexis Tsipras himself has recently said, in his speech at the third congress of SYRIZA.

The “participation” case has been taken over and Mr. Tsipras is running from here and within the next two weeks, starting from today when he is visiting Ilia, he is planned to “plow” the Territory, sending an invitation to participate to increase his rally. party.

Injuries and current

At the forefront of SYRIZA’s opposition spear is certainly the energy crisis and the explosive increases in the price of energy. Koumoundourou attacks with undiminished intensity the Government for the adjustment clause while launched an attack on the Energy Regulatory Authority, through its representative, Nasos Iliopoulosstating that he is “playing hide and seek” with the Government.

SYRIZA’s concern that the war in Ukraine could provide an “alibi” for the government to be precise has long dictated its opposition strategy: ““Accuracy in electricity and goods must be identified with the prime minister and the government.”is the motto of Koumoundourou, hence on a daily basis the public rhetoric of its executives revolves around personnel around the prime ministerial choices:

“The adjustment clause is a Mitsotaki clause” said (again yesterday) N. Iliopoulos, emphasizing (again) that “with the violent de-ligation that the government proceeded, the country’s dependence on Russian gas increased, while with its privatization “PPC ended today, instead of having a PPC that intervenes in the market, to operate with the sole criterion that its share is going well”.

It is also expected the tabling of the previously announced amendment for the adjustment clause, according to which consumers will have the option of not paying it until the justice to which the presidium of the plenary of the bar associations has appealed.

For the rest, at least until the internal party process of May 15, SYRIZA is attempting – if not to close- the wounds left by the conference within the party, at least to soften so as not to invigorate the project.
